Job Description

Overview

AmTrust is seeking a motivated tax intern ready to learn about the various Corporate Tax functions which include compliance information reporting tax accounting and automation of manual processes through the utilization of tax technology applications. This role accelerates your learning and development by providing a solid foundation upon which to build your tax accounting career. You will assist with a wide range of duties that include analyzing data preparing tax returns and learning different components of ASC 740 reporting. You will work crossfunctionally with various departments to support our process and gain exposure to bestinclass systems and processes. By the end of the internship you will have a solid grasp of the tax accounting lifecycle.

Responsibilities

  • Develop a working knowledge the key systems that support tax accounting and the financial reporting process.
  • Learn to navigate and become proficient in software programs utilized by the tax department.
  • Assist with meeting corporate tax compliance deliverables by their due dates.
  • Learn to prepare corporate tax returns and supporting workpapers (federal income tax returns and state and local income tax returns)
  • Collaborate with NonInsurance and Insurance Federal State and Local and International tax groups on various deliverables/due dates.
  • Provide support for quarter close which includes provision preparation account reconciliations and analysis.
  • Perform necessary research to support understanding of related tax compliance or other technical tax issues
  • Enhance and develop communication and critical thinking skills.
  • Identify opportunities for process improvement and assist with ongoing projects.

Qualifications

Successful candidates possess problem solving and analytical skills attention to detail ability to prioritize planning and organizational skills manage time effectively good verbal and communication skills in order to collaborate with various departments.

  • Currently pursuing an undergraduate degree in Accounting or Taxation. Also Master of Accounting or JD Major.
  • Strong academic track record (minimum GPA of 3.0
  • Basic understanding of financial and tax accounting principles.
  • Proven ability to work as part of a team.
  • Ability to work in a fastpaced environment.
  • Strong organizational skills.
  • Experience with Excel.
  • Analytical and problemsolving abilities.

This role is hybrid out of the Cleveland OH office and is compensated at $20/hour.
